  1. The Right Sofas

The most common mistake that people make is that they bring in cheap furniture items and compromise comfort to save some money. You may feel like you are making the right call, and you might even be proud of it, but you will soon find out that you couldn’t be more wrong. It is best to make sensible investments while choosing furniture for your living room. Bring in the right sofas, and make sure that you place them nicely so that it doesn’t look like that the room is just to watch TV.

  1. A Cohesive Color Palette

The most crucial role in making a room look aesthetic is of the color palette that you choose for your living room. Going with a loud color scheme and decorating the entire room based on that is a bad idea. Try and spread the tones instead so that you can achieve a balanced look that exhibits elegance. Look for items that suit your room’s aura and aren’t monochromatic to get the best results.

  1. Perfect Layout

The greatest mistake that most people while decorating a living is that they don’t plan a layout for it. Stuffing everything that you feel should be in a room just for the sake of it often disturbs the entire setup. The best way to design a sitting room is by choosing a focal point for it like a center table, or a screen. You can place everything revolving around that and make sure that the room doesn’t get too crowded with the moveables.

  1. Flooring

Some people like carpet rugs over marbles and tiles, or even wooden flooring. It is only a matter of choice, but it is best to choose the most convenient option. Carpets are often tedious to clean, and in the unfortunate case of a bad spill, you might have to consider replacing the whole thing. Compared to it, all the other types of flooring can bear the furniture weight and the rough use rather well.

  1. Lighting

The purpose of living isn’t just to sit and entertain yourself, but you should be able to read and spend some quality alone time while sitting there. Lights play a huge role in making this possible. Having overhead lamps that can help you get just the right amount of light for reading or dim lights that gives off a soothing impression are a blessing. Give some careful thought to this area while redesigning.

  1. Avoid Showroom Looks

The worst possible case that you can end up with while decorating a living room is to have a showroom instead. Bringing the most delicate and expensive furniture won’t be your best call while renovating. Keep in mind that it is a room for robust use, and you can’t afford to replace expensive furniture frequently. And compromising your satisfaction just for exhibition purposes is nothing but poor use of space. It is always better to compromise a little and focus on the bigger picture, so avoid going fancy and sassy while decorating it.

  1. Personalization

Another significant aspect of a living room is the touch of personalization that you add to it, which also exposes elements of your personality. You can choose to do this with artwork or layouts.
